North Caucasus № 48 (1984)

Newsreel №43372, 1 part
Production: North-Caucasian newsreel studio
Availability:Film hasn't been digitized
Director:L.Magkeeva
Camera operators:A.Attaev, Chon Nin Gu, V.Bondarj, M.Hakulov

Reel №1

In newsreel includes the following topics:

1st plot.

Biologics.

The plot tells of Stavropol Biofabryka.

In the story the following filming: general view of the institute building, industrial processes in the shops of the enterprise; interview factory director Professor G.F.Denisenko (sinhr. and frame.)  factory employees at work in the laboratory, a panorama of the laboratory instrument.

2nd story.

Farm "Cajun".

In the story tells of forage necessary for rearing farms and farm replenishment highly productive cows.

In the story the following filming: a panorama of the livestock complex in Kabardino-Balkar farm "Cajun"; harvesting forage grasses on the farm; trucks with green mass of corn for silage silage go to a place; cows on the farm, mechanized delivery of hay to the stables; tractor driven trailers with hay on the farm, unloading hay; farm leaders on a farm.

Third plot.

Dry Cleaning on wheels.

The story tells about the new services of the production association "Daghimchistka."

In the story the following filming: a car with NDP "Urgent dry" rides on the highway; workers and livestock Kochubeevsky Babayurt regions of the republic pass things to the dry cleaners on wheels; general view of the process of emergency cleaning, ironing product after cleaning with otparochnogo dummy issue after cleaning products.

4th story.

Palace of health.

Theme is a new clinic for motorists in Kabardino-Balkaria.

In the plot was filming the following: general view of the building clinics, physical therapy office, of X-ray, ingolyatoriya, treatment room, physiotherapy room,  mud baths, a swimming pool; clinic patients in the registry, at the reception of physicians and dentists during procedures in one of the classrooms.

5th plot.

Premiere Theatre.

The theme is the premiere of the play by the Bulgarian playwright N.Iordanova "Mata Hari" at the North Ossetian Republican Russian Drama Theater in a production directed by Bulgarian D.Ignatova.

In the story the following filming: scenes from the play, the audience in the hall watching the action of the play, the actors applauded; director receives congratulations; interview with director D.Ignatova (sinhr. and frame.)
